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Add shared-state-async network statistics sharing #1087

Merged
merged 1 commit into from
Feb 26, 2024

Conversation

G10h4ck
Copy link
Member

@G10h4ck G10h4ck commented Feb 22, 2024

No description provided.

@G10h4ck G10h4ck added this to the mesh-wide milestone Feb 22, 2024
@ilario
Copy link
Member

ilario commented Feb 24, 2024 via email

@G10h4ck
Copy link
Member Author

G10h4ck commented Feb 24, 2024

This stuff (and in general what is meant for mesh-wide milestone) is developed on top (and depends) on OpenWrt development branch, as an example shared-state-async depends on a GCC version which is not shipped yet in OpenWrt stable releases, otherwise it will not compile properly.
So doing the change you suggests hoping for retro-compatibility would be futile.

@G10h4ck
Copy link
Member Author

G10h4ck commented Feb 24, 2024

other even more retro-compatibility breaking stuff is coming to out of my experimentation to have better support for newer radios https://www.youtube.com/live/DOH5FBMTXmE?feature=shared&t=10848

@ilario
Copy link
Member

ilario commented Feb 26, 2024

Ok, will it work at least on OpenWrt 23?
If not, please do not propose those changes on the master branch, which is being used for preparing a release based on OpenWrt 23 (we could also create a branch for the release...).

@G10h4ck
Copy link
Member Author

G10h4ck commented Feb 26, 2024

AFAIU it will not work on OpenWrt 23 either, @javierbrk tried to compile and failed because of not enough recent compiler AFAIR

Better creating a branch for the planned release and backport there stuff if needed, while development keep staying on master branch

@ilario
Copy link
Member

ilario commented Feb 26, 2024

Ok, please create a branch with the code you know will work with OpenWrt 23.

@G10h4ck
Copy link
Member Author

G10h4ck commented Feb 26, 2024

Ain't got time for that last compatible commit should be this a5eb7d8

@pony1k
Copy link
Contributor

pony1k commented Feb 26, 2024

AFAIU it will not work on OpenWrt 23 either, @javierbrk tried to compile and failed because of not enough recent compiler AFAIR

I compiled shared-state-async from a823f47 for OpenWrt 23.05.2 and it is working.

@javierbrk
Copy link
Collaborator

javierbrk commented Feb 26, 2024 via email

@G10h4ck
Copy link
Member Author

G10h4ck commented Feb 26, 2024

Good news! So we can go ahead without dealing with multiple branches for now

@G10h4ck G10h4ck merged commit 6992335 into libremesh:master Feb 26, 2024
1 check pass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

None yet

5 participants